Mainz Wheel Boundary Stone

Highlight • Monument

A boundary stone with the Mainz wheel.
The Mainzer Rad is a common figure in the heraldry of the city of Mainz in Rhineland-Palatinate. It is a proper-named coat of arms depicting a six-spoke silver wheel on a red background. In order to distinguish it from the former Electoral State of Mainz, the city's coat of arms has a double wheel connected to a cross instead of a single one. The state of Rhineland-Palatinate and many municipalities that are historically connected to the city or the Electorate of Mainz also have the wheel in their coats of arms. In addition, it can still be found today on many stone carvings - for example on old boundary stones - as well as on medieval seals and similar works.

Sandfang Pond

Highlight • Lake

In good weather a very nice place for cycling and walking. A lap around the "sand trap" is about three kilometers and is very flat and easy to drive / run.

Bicycle Fence and Model Railway

Highlight • Structure

Someone with a lot of creativity lives in this house on Fernradweg R2. The fence consists partly of old bicycles, a model railway drives across the garden area and you can also discover some other curiosities here. Not just great fun with children, stopping here and looking at the total work of art.

Kirchhain Sculpture Trail

Highlight • Trail

The Kirchhain sculpture trail is the result of civic engagement in our city. Some of the artistic suggestions came from the citizens of Kirchhain, who were also involved in financially supporting the overall project.

The sculpture trail is approximately two kilometers long. It connects the train station with the Erlensee. It leads through the pedestrian zone, the heart of Kirchhain's city center, past the "Große Mühle". It crosses the Annapark (designed by the Siesmayer brothers) and continues to the Erlensee.

The path leads into a nature reserve with an extraordinary diversity of flora and fauna. You can visit an acoustic station in which nature becomes “audible”. Blind people are thought of in a special way. The nature trail and an associated tree trail are signposted for blind people using braille.
